A device employed for creating a new service connection to a pressurized water main, this equipment allows the safe and efficient installation of a branch connection without interrupting the existing water supply. This process typically involves securing the device to the main, drilling a hole through the pipe wall, and then inserting a valve and fitting assembly. The assembly provides a controlled outlet for the new service line.

This technology is critical for expanding water distribution networks and providing service to new customers while minimizing disruption to existing users. It represents a significant advancement over older methods that required shutting down the main, draining the line, and making the connection under non-pressurized conditions. This innovation offers substantial time and cost savings, reduces water loss, and minimizes the inconvenience to consumers. Its development has been essential for the efficient growth and maintenance of modern water infrastructure.

A household water recycling setup uses gently used water from laundry appliances for purposes other than drinking. This typically involves diverting the discharge from the washer to a designated storage or distribution system. For example, the collected water, after appropriate filtration, can be used for landscape irrigation.

Redirecting this resource offers significant advantages, including water conservation and reduced reliance on municipal supplies. It can also lessen the strain on septic or sewer systems. The practice has historical precedents, with simpler forms employed for centuries in water-scarce regions. Modern systems, however, incorporate advanced filtration and sometimes disinfection technologies to ensure the safety and efficacy of reuse.

Purified through a boiling and condensation process, this specific type of water is free from minerals, impurities, and dissolved solids. Using this method eliminates substances that could otherwise accumulate inside an espresso machine, potentially affecting its performance and the taste of the brewed coffee.

The absence of minerals prevents scale buildup within the boiler and other internal components. Scale, a common problem in espresso machines, can restrict water flow, reduce heating efficiency, and even lead to premature failure of the machine. Additionally, using this purified water can enhance the flavor profile of espresso by preventing mineral interference, allowing the nuanced notes of the coffee beans to shine through. This practice has become increasingly common with the rise of sophisticated espresso machines and a greater appreciation for specialty coffee.

A compact, digitally controlled fabrication tool utilizes a high-pressure stream of water, often mixed with an abrasive substance, to precisely cut a wide array of materials. This technology allows for intricate designs and detailed cuts on materials ranging from metals and plastics to glass and composites, all within a smaller footprint suitable for workshops, studios, or small-scale production environments. Imagine crafting complex jewelry pieces or precisely cutting heat-sensitive electronics components, all within a relatively small workspace.

The accessibility of this scaled-down technology offers significant advantages. It empowers smaller businesses and individual artisans with industrial-grade cutting capabilities without the need for large facilities or extensive capital investment. Its precision minimizes material waste, contributing to cost-effectiveness and sustainability. Furthermore, the cold cutting process eliminates heat-affected zones, preserving the integrity of delicate materials. This technology has evolved from larger, industrial systems, adapting the power and precision of waterjet cutting to a more manageable and affordable scale, opening up new possibilities for diverse applications.

A filtration device plumbed directly into a washing machine’s water supply line intercepts sediment, rust, and other impurities before they reach the appliance. This type of filter typically resides between the water shut-off valve and the washing machine’s inlet hose. Common examples include simple sediment filters and more advanced multi-stage systems that may incorporate activated carbon.

Cleaner water entering the washing machine contributes to several advantages. It can prolong the lifespan of the appliance by preventing internal component scaling and corrosion. Furthermore, cleaner water can improve washing effectiveness, requiring less detergent and potentially reducing fabric wear. Historically, such pre-filtration was less common, but with increasing awareness of water quality issues and the desire to maximize appliance longevity, these devices have become more prevalent.

Abrasive waterjets utilize a high-pressure stream of water mixed with an abrasive garnet to cut through a wide array of materials, from metals and composites to stone and glass. This technology offers exceptional precision and versatility, often eliminating the need for secondary finishing processes. A specific brand known for its advanced precision cutting systems exemplifies this technology’s capabilities.

These systems provide significant advantages in various industries. The cold cutting process minimizes heat-affected zones, preserving material integrity and reducing the risk of warping or distortion. This characteristic makes the technology particularly suitable for heat-sensitive materials. Moreover, the ability to cut intricate shapes and complex geometries opens design possibilities and streamlines manufacturing processes. The technology’s origins can be traced back to the early 1970s, with continued advancements leading to the sophisticated, computer-controlled systems available today.

These devices generate ozone, a powerful oxidizing agent, and introduce it into water for various purification purposes. A typical application involves treating well water to eliminate bacteria, viruses, and other microorganisms. The process leverages ozone’s strong oxidative properties to neutralize contaminants and improve water quality.

Water treated with this method often exhibits enhanced clarity, taste, and odor. Historically, ozone has been employed for water disinfection in municipal settings due to its efficacy and relatively quick reaction time. Compared to other chemical disinfectants, ozone leaves minimal residual byproducts, contributing to its appeal for various applications, from residential well sanitation to industrial wastewater treatment.
